Enhance Skin Tightening Spa Treatments

As we age, our skin naturally loses the collagen and elastin that provide its youthful structure and bounce. This process often leads to sagging, fine lines, and a loss of definition along the jawline and neck. Fortunately, modern advancements in aesthetic technology have made skin tightening spa treatments more accessible and effective than ever before, offering non-surgical alternatives to traditional facelifts.

Choosing the right skin tightening spa treatments requires an understanding of how different technologies interact with your skin’s biology. These professional procedures are designed to stimulate the body’s natural healing response, encouraging the production of new collagen deep within the dermis. By targeting the underlying structural layers, these treatments provide a lifting effect that topical creams simply cannot achieve.

Understanding Radiofrequency (RF) Therapy

Radiofrequency therapy is one of the most popular skin tightening spa treatments available today. This technology uses energy waves to heat the deep layers of your skin, known as the dermis. This heat induces a process called thermal remodeling, which causes existing collagen fibers to contract and stimulates the growth of new ones.

Patients often prefer RF treatments because they are generally painless and require no downtime. Over a series of sessions, the skin becomes noticeably firmer and smoother. It is particularly effective for treating the delicate area around the eyes, the forehead, and the lower face where jowls may begin to form.

The Benefits of Microneedling with RF

For those looking for more intensive results, combining microneedling with radiofrequency is a game-changer. This dual-action approach creates microscopic channels in the skin while simultaneously delivering RF energy deep into the tissue. This synergy maximizes the tightening effect and improves overall skin texture and tone.

  • Increased Collagen Production: The physical micro-injuries and thermal energy work together to boost skin density.
  • Minimized Pore Size: As the skin tightens, pores often appear smaller and more refined.
  • Scar Reduction: This method is also highly effective for smoothing out acne scars and stretch marks.

Ultrasound Technology for Deep Tissue Lifting

Another cornerstone of professional skin tightening spa treatments is high-intensity focused ultrasound (HIFU). Unlike RF, which heats the superficial layers, ultrasound energy can reach the foundational layers of the skin, including the SMAS (superficial muscular aponeurotic system) layer typically addressed in surgical facelifts.

Ultrasound treatments are highly targeted, allowing practitioners to focus on specific areas of concern with precision. Because the energy bypasses the surface of the skin, there is no damage to the outer layer, making it an excellent “lunchtime” procedure for busy individuals. Results typically develop over two to three months as the new collagen matures.

Laser Skin Tightening and Resurfacing

Laser-based skin tightening spa treatments use infrared light sources to tighten the skin by heating the collagen under the skin’s surface. This causes the skin to tighten immediately while also promoting long-term collagen growth. Laser treatments are often categorized into ablative and non-ablative options.

Non-ablative lasers are preferred for skin tightening because they do not remove the top layer of skin, leading to faster recovery times. These treatments are excellent for improving the appearance of fine lines and mild skin laxity on the face, neck, and chest. Many clients choose laser therapy to complement other aesthetic procedures for a comprehensive rejuvenation.

What to Expect During Your Appointment

When you arrive for skin tightening spa treatments, a trained aesthetician or medical professional will first assess your skin type and goals. Most treatments begin with a thorough cleansing of the target area. Depending on the technology used, a cooling gel or a topical numbing cream may be applied to ensure your comfort throughout the session.

The duration of the treatment can range from 30 to 90 minutes. You may feel a sensation of warmth or a slight tingling, but most modern devices are designed with integrated cooling systems to protect the skin. After the procedure, your skin might appear slightly flushed, similar to a mild sunburn, but this usually subsides within a few hours.

Choosing the Best Treatment for Your Skin Type

Not all skin tightening spa treatments are created equal, and the best choice depends on your specific needs. Factors such as your age, the degree of skin laxity, and your skin tone all play a role in determining the most effective protocol. Consulting with a specialist is the best way to create a customized plan.

  1. Mild Sagging: Radiofrequency is often the first line of defense for early signs of aging.
  2. Moderate Laxity: Ultrasound or RF Microneedling may be recommended for deeper structural support.
  3. Texture Issues: Laser resurfacing is ideal if you want to address both tightness and surface imperfections like sun spots.

Post-Treatment Care and Longevity

To maximize the results of your skin tightening spa treatments, proper aftercare is essential. Protecting your skin from UV damage is the most critical step, as sun exposure can break down the very collagen your treatment worked to build. Always apply a broad-spectrum SPF 30 or higher daily.

Hydration also plays a key role in skin health. Drinking plenty of water and using high-quality topical antioxidants like Vitamin C can support the remodeling process. While some immediate tightening may be visible, the full results of these treatments usually manifest over several months as your body produces new structural proteins.
